MOT Attends 20th Riyadh MoU Cmte. Meeting
Thursday, February 23, 2023
MOT Attends 20th Riyadh MoU Cmte. Meeting

Riyadh- An MOT delegation has attended the 20th Meeting of Committee on Riyadh MoU on Port State Control; an agreement to achieve safe, secure and efficient shipping in the maritime jurisdictions in the Gulf region, as per the provisions of global maritime conventions of the IMO. The delegation included Asst. Undersecretary, Maritime Transport Affairs, Dr. Saleh bin Fetais Al-Marri, and several maritime transportation officials from MOT. Held in Muscat, the meeting discussed the MoU’s strategic plan for the next 5 years, and updating the committee’s financial and administrative approach by setting out the procedures that can ensure a transition to an advanced port state control mechanism in accordance with other international MoUs. It also discussed procedures of ensuring ships’ compliance with the global requirements for protecting lives and property at seas, in addition to other meeting agenda items.

Minister Meets with UNECE Executive Secretary
Tuesday, February 21, 2023
Minister Meets with UNECE Executive Secretary

Geneva – Switzerland Minister of Transport H.E. Jassim Saif Ahmed Al-Sulaiti met in Geneva with Executive Secretary of the UN Economic Commission for Europe (UNECE) Ms. Olga Algayerova, on the sidelines of the 85th Session of the Inland Transport Committee (ITC) of the UNECE. The two officials discussed enhancing Qatar-UN cooperation in the areas of transportation. They also discussed inland transportation solutions, particularly those relating to harnessing the potentials of transportation solutions in the global action against climate change. During the meeting, Minister Al-Sulaiti highlighted the ecofriendly Transportation Master Plan for Qatar where sustainability is a key foundation. Qatar is one of the world’s high-ranking countries in the field of clean transportation thanks to providing an integrated, multimodal transit system with environment-conscious services such as the metro, trams, and e-buses, in addition to upgrading the specifications of truck and equipment engines to EURO5-equivalent clean diesel fuel, thus ensuring achieving the QNV2030. Qatar’s Permanent Representative to the UN Office at Geneva H.E. Dr. Hend Abdalrahman Al-Muftah attended the meeting.

Minister Attends UN ITC High-Level Meeting in Geneva
Tuesday, February 21, 2023
Minister Attends UN ITC High-Level Meeting in Geneva

Geneva – Switzerland Minister of Transport H.E. Jassim Saif Ahmed Al-Sulaiti has attended the high-level meeting of the Inland Transport Committee (ITC) of the UN Economic Commission for Europe (UNECE), as the 85th Session of the ITC convenes in Geneva, Switzerland. Themed, “Actions of the Inland Transport Sector to Join the Global Fight Against Climate Change,” the meeting featured transportation ministers and high-profile officials and representatives from around the world, who discussed issues relative to curbing greenhouse gas emissions trends from inland transportation.
